Research Teams

independent, radical, progressive

ippr has established itself as one of the most influential think tanks in British politics. Our work has always been driven by a belief in the importance of fairness, democracy and sustainability. Working with all parties and from all parts of the United Kingdom, ippr prides itself on its independence and influence across political divides.

But, at a time of economic and political crisis, it is clear we now need more radical thinking to take this agenda forward.

Through our Global Change and Citizens, Society and Economy programmes we are anticipating and shaping responses to the economic and political challenges faced by the UK.
